How Does Positive Reinforcement Enhance Dog Training Reno Results?
Positive reinforcement is a highly effective dog training method. It focuses on rewarding desired behaviors with treats or praise. This approach builds trust and makes learning enjoyable for dogs. It encourages cooperation without relying on punishment. Dogs become eager to please when training is a positive experience.

Dog Training Reno Quick Reference
| Service Type | Description | Typical Age Range | Benefits |
| Puppy Classes | Socialization and basic manners for young dogs. | 8-16 weeks | Early social skills, foundation commands. |
| Basic Obedience | Commands like sit, stay, come, leash manners. | 4 months and up | Improved control, reduced behavioral issues. |
| Behavior Modification | Addressing specific problems like aggression, anxiety. | All ages | Custom solutions for complex behaviors. |
| Advanced Training | Off-leash control, complex commands, specialized skills. | 6 months and up | Enhanced responsiveness, higher skill level. |
| Private Sessions | One-on-one training tailored to individual needs. | All ages | Personalized attention, flexible scheduling. |
| Group Classes | Training in a social setting with other dogs. | All ages | Socialization opportunities, cost-effective. |

How much does dog training cost in Reno?
Dog training costs in Reno vary widely based on the program type and trainer experience. Group classes might range from $150 to $300 for a series. Private sessions can be $75 to $150 per hour or more. Package deals often provide better value. Always inquire about detailed pricing and what is included in each program option.
